Все про USBAsp

Обсуждаем контроллеры компании Atmel.
Аватара пользователя
VNS
Говорящий с текстолитом
Сообщения: 1614
Зарегистрирован: Пт дек 10, 2021 12:48:46
Откуда: Тюмень

Re: Все про USBAsp

Сообщение VNS »

[uquote="Levontay",url="/forum/viewtopic.php?p=4175375#p4175375"]То-есть вы настаиваете - что стирать Атмегу328 можно не выпаивая?[/uquote]
Не воспринимайте всё за чистую монету… это лок биты стираются при стирании МК, но в Вашем случае это не нужно, так как Ваш случай не в их… Ваш случай совершенно иной… как уже неоднократно говорено. :) Вернуть фьюзы на заводскую установку с помощью "доктора" можно и не выпаивая МК из Вашей платы. Но только при условии, что Вы выпаяете все те элементы которые будут мешать при манипуляции с "доктором". А именно: резисторы (все R*; R1; R3-R5; R7-R11; R13-R15), конденсаторы (С7; C8) в том числе и кварц, транзисторы (Q2).
А я уже руки опустил, уже купил вчера новую Атмегу
Если уже есть новый МК, то с ним лучше потренироваться на макетке. Опыт выпаивания контроллеров имеется? Если есть фен, то можно им. А если нет, то лучший способ удаления припоя это медная оплётка...
[uquote="oleg63m",url="/forum/viewtopic.php?p=4175097#p4175097"]убить мегу надо еще постараться[/uquote]

- Это интересно.
Это образное выражение… ничего интересного, так как пока для Вас он уже "убит"… ведь Ваш программатор его не видит. :) Что касается убития выводов МК, так это дело совершено лёгкое... :)))
[uquote="oleg63m",url="/forum/viewtopic.php?p=4174482#p4174482"]не говорите так никогда[/uquote]

- это интересно.
Ничего интересного… просто был выбран неправильный термин, но смысл о чём писал GoldenAndy совершенно правильный. Просто в место слова бит, необходимо было использовать пин. Вот по сути и всё. oleg63m пафосно на это обратил внимание. А мог бы это сделать мягче… :dont_know: Но повторюсь, основная мысль про вывод МК была описана верно. Но Вам похоже это ничего не сказало. :roll:
Аватара пользователя
GoldenAndy
Поставщик валерьянки для Кота
Сообщения: 1925
Зарегистрирован: Чт июл 28, 2016 07:58:37
Откуда: Kyiv, UA
Контактная информация:

Re: Все про USBAsp

Сообщение GoldenAndy »

VNS, ну если доколупываться до слов, то пин порта - это железная ножка. Убить ее тяжело. Разве что сломать. Или испарить килоамперным импульсом.
Наверное, правильней говорить "выходной каскад одной из линий порта ввода-вывода" :) Как то так.

Кстати, касательно выпайки многоножек без фена.
В конце девяностых-начале двухтысячных, когда я барыжил железом на радиорынке, у нас был свой ремонтник. Который без фена запросто выпаивал большие чипы. Из трех условно рабочих VooDoo2 мог собрать одну рабочую.
СпойлерИзображение
Выпаивал он такой чип просто - просовывал тонкую-тонкую нихромовую проволочку под ряд ножек чипа и, прогревая ноги последовательно паяльником, вытаскивал эту проволочку под ножками. Говорит - на всё про всё - минуты 2, и из них 70% времени - пропхать проволочку.
ИзображениеИзображение
Изображение
 
Telegram               Лучшая благодарность ->
[+]
Аватара пользователя
VNS
Говорящий с текстолитом
Сообщения: 1614
Зарегистрирован: Пт дек 10, 2021 12:48:46
Откуда: Тюмень

Re: Все про USBAsp

Сообщение VNS »

[uquote="GoldenAndy",url="/forum/viewtopic.php?p=4175546#p4175546"]VNS, ну если доколупываться до слов, то пин порта - это железная ножка.[/uquote]
Если Вы решили докапываться до слов, то сами применяйте правильные выражения. А то выглядит это как-то не очень… :wink:
Выводы микроконтроллеров делают, или из меди, или из платенита, или (реже) из ковара. Но не как не из железа. :beer:
Говорит - на всё про всё - минуты 2, и из них 70% времени - пропхать проволочку.
Вы сами попробуйте без навыка воспользоваться таким методом. :facepalm: К тому же ещё необходимо найти "тонкую-тонкую нихромовую проволочку". Уж медную оплётку куда легче найти, да и навыки особые не требуются при её использовании. :solder:
Novice user
Мудрый кот
Сообщения: 1704
Зарегистрирован: Вт янв 05, 2016 10:14:25
Откуда: поселок Мелеуз

Re: Все про USBAsp

Сообщение Novice user »

Я обычной медной незачищенной/незалуженной выпаивал атмега8 и атмега16
Аватара пользователя
oleg63m
Друг Кота
Сообщения: 20132
Зарегистрирован: Чт сен 01, 2011 12:53:27
Откуда: ТьмуТаракания. Почетный житель подмостовья
Контактная информация:

Re: Все про USBAsp

Сообщение oleg63m »

[uquote="VNS",url="/forum/viewtopic.php?p=4175637#p4175637"]попробуйте без навыка воспользоваться таким методом. :facepalm: К тому же ещё необходимо найти "тонкую-тонкую нихромовую проволочку". Уж медную оплётку куда легче найти, да и навыки особые не требуются при её использовании. :solder:[/uquote]
свою первую многоногую TQFP я именно таким способом и выпаивал. причем не имея никакого опыта выпаивания. нихром можно взять со сгоревшего паяльника, ватт на 100. можно и меньше не принципиально. можно использовать самую тонкую гитарную струну.
единственное, что не стоит торопиться сейчас много безсвинцовых паек, температура плавления высокая у такого припоя, поэтому вопрос что первым отскочит нога, или дорожка от стеклотекстолита. я бы посоветовал на крайняк взять, хотя-бы строительный фен. включить его через диммер. но перед этим на ютубе просмотреть саму технику выпаивания.
раз есть другая микра, на замену, то конечно лучше поменять, а нерабочую перенести на макетку и с ней уже изгаляться, получите за одно безценный опыт.

и, кстати, залочить spien и rstdisbl простым программатором не всегда удается, они этого просто не делают, так что как вариант
почитайте здесь, букав много, но ситуация схожая.
https://forum.cxem.net/index.php?/topic ... %81%D1%8F/

полезняк про тактирование https://www.radiokot.ru/forum/viewtopic ... 1#p2841091
и вот тут немножко, даже с вашей проблемою

https://yandex.ru/search/?text=%D0%BA%D ... suggest_In
Шекспир сказал: Судить меня -дано лишь Богу, другим я укажу дорогу... https://natribu.org/
Я его полностью поддерживаю.
Программирую на Fuse AtmelAVR.
Аватара пользователя
GoldenAndy
Поставщик валерьянки для Кота
Сообщения: 1925
Зарегистрирован: Чт июл 28, 2016 07:58:37
Откуда: Kyiv, UA
Контактная информация:

Re: Все про USBAsp

Сообщение GoldenAndy »

oleg63m, spien- не получится.
А rstdsbl- аж влёт.

VNS, доколупываться начал не я. Так что сорри. И я под словом "железо" имел в виду не 100% Fe, а то, что нога из металла.

По выпайке - pin1000 говорил, что он обмоточным проводом 0.2-0.3 выпаивает. Именно таким методом.
Хотя я не вижу практического смысла сохранять МК, у которого с высокой долей вероятности убита часть выходного каскада одной из линий порта ввода-вывода.
Можно канцелярским ножом (без фанатизма!) прорезать ноги, снять паяльником остатки ножек, и запаять новый МК.
ИзображениеИзображение
Изображение
 
Telegram               Лучшая благодарность ->
[+]
Аватара пользователя
VNS
Говорящий с текстолитом
Сообщения: 1614
Зарегистрирован: Пт дек 10, 2021 12:48:46
Откуда: Тюмень

Re: Все про USBAsp

Сообщение VNS »

[uquote="GoldenAndy",url="/forum/viewtopic.php?p=4175879#p4175879"]Хотя я не вижу практического смысла сохранять МК, у которого с высокой долей вероятности убита часть выходного каскада одной из линий порта ввода-вывода.[/uquote]
Ну это только предположение. :) После реанимации фьюзов можно было бы проверить работу всех выводов тестовой прошивкой. И уже после этого делать выводы. Так или иначе, лучшим решением всё же, это поменять МК. К тому же он уже есть. А что делать со старым, это уже дело десятое.
Что касается демонтажа старого, всё же остаюсь при своём мнении, лучшим способом при отсутствии фена, это медная оплётка. Но своё мнение ни в коем случае не навязываю, так как решать как это сделать будет сам ТС. :solder:
Аватара пользователя
GoldenAndy
Поставщик валерьянки для Кота
Сообщения: 1925
Зарегистрирован: Чт июл 28, 2016 07:58:37
Откуда: Kyiv, UA
Контактная информация:

Re: Все про USBAsp

Сообщение GoldenAndy »

Медная оплетка само собой. Но она не высосет _весь_ припой из-под ног. А проволокой может и получится.
Я как то по бедности вообще куском бумаги снимал что то многоножечное в соике. принцип тот же, но не проволока, а бумага.
ИзображениеИзображение
Изображение
 
Telegram               Лучшая благодарность ->
[+]
Аватара пользователя
oleg63m
Друг Кота
Сообщения: 20132
Зарегистрирован: Чт сен 01, 2011 12:53:27
Откуда: ТьмуТаракания. Почетный житель подмостовья
Контактная информация:

Re: Все про USBAsp

Сообщение oleg63m »

[uquote="GoldenAndy",url="/forum/viewtopic.php?p=4175879#p4175879"]oleg63m, spien- не получится.
А rstdsbl- аж влёт..[/uquote]
вечером проверю. правда на меге8. давно не шил ничего, что-бы нужно было ресет перенаправлять
Шекспир сказал: Судить меня -дано лишь Богу, другим я укажу дорогу... https://natribu.org/
Я его полностью поддерживаю.
Программирую на Fuse AtmelAVR.
Аватара пользователя
GoldenAndy
Поставщик валерьянки для Кота
Сообщения: 1925
Зарегистрирован: Чт июл 28, 2016 07:58:37
Откуда: Kyiv, UA
Контактная информация:

Re: Все про USBAsp

Сообщение GoldenAndy »

oleg63m, так в ДШ сказано - фьюз spien можно выключить только параллельным программатором. Про остальные ничего не говорится.
ИзображениеИзображение
Изображение
 
Telegram               Лучшая благодарность ->
[+]
Аватара пользователя
VNS
Говорящий с текстолитом
Сообщения: 1614
Зарегистрирован: Пт дек 10, 2021 12:48:46
Откуда: Тюмень

Re: Все про USBAsp

Сообщение VNS »

[uquote="oleg63m",url="/forum/viewtopic.php?p=4176300#p4176300"][uquote="GoldenAndy",url="/forum/viewtopic.php?p=4175879#p4175879"]oleg63m, spien- не получится.[/uquote]
вечером проверю.[/uquote]
Подтверждаю! :) Данный бит отказывается шить... если его сбрасываешь, программа его автоматом восстанавливает при прошивке фьюзов. :)) Пробовал тогда когда появился "доктор". Ради испытаний доктора... но пришлось при проверке доктора пин резет сбрасывать... :roll:
Аватара пользователя
GoldenAndy
Поставщик валерьянки для Кота
Сообщения: 1925
Зарегистрирован: Чт июл 28, 2016 07:58:37
Откуда: Kyiv, UA
Контактная информация:

Re: Все про USBAsp

Сообщение GoldenAndy »

VNS, Это не программа сбрасывает, а МК не даёт.
ИзображениеИзображение
Изображение
 
Telegram               Лучшая благодарность ->
[+]
Аватара пользователя
VNS
Говорящий с текстолитом
Сообщения: 1614
Зарегистрирован: Пт дек 10, 2021 12:48:46
Откуда: Тюмень

Re: Все про USBAsp

Сообщение VNS »

Возможно и так, но визуально кажется как будто программа перед шитьём фюзов сбрасывает данный бит, а уже затем прошивает. По крайней мере мне так показалось… как там на железном уровне происходит я не в курсе. :dont_know: :)
Аватара пользователя
GoldenAndy
Поставщик валерьянки для Кота
Сообщения: 1925
Зарегистрирован: Чт июл 28, 2016 07:58:37
Откуда: Kyiv, UA
Контактная информация:

Re: Все про USBAsp

Сообщение GoldenAndy »

VNS, может и програма сбрасывает тоже. Я внимания не обращал. Но в ДШ указано, что сброс spien через последовательное программирование игнорируется контроллером:
Notes: 1. The SPIEN Fuse is not accessible in Serial Programming mode
ИзображениеИзображение
Изображение
 
Telegram               Лучшая благодарность ->
[+]
Levontay
Вымогатель припоя
Сообщения: 667
Зарегистрирован: Ср ноя 18, 2020 15:42:36

Re: Все про USBAsp

Сообщение Levontay »

[uquote="GoldenAndy",url="/forum/viewtopic.php?p=4175879#p4175879"]Хотя я не вижу практического смысла сохранять МК - у которого с высокой долей вероятности убита часть выходного каскада одной из линий порта ввода-вывода.
Можно канцелярским ножом (без фанатизма!) прорезать ноги, снять паяльником остатки ножек, и запаять новый МК.[/uquote]

Во-во! Когда меня в радиокружке учили - как налаживать платы - мне привели пример мастера - который при каждом действии вырезает подвопросную микросхему ножом, впаивет новую, убеждается в отсутствии изменений и переходит к следующей.

Я ножом тоже делал - пятидесятиножечные диповские прямоугольники. С smd я тока начинаю возиться. А вообще, если-бы небыло фена, я, делал так: набухивал на ряд(Ы) ножек побольше олова (свинцового припоя) - разогревал всё, и, пока оно долго стыло - прогревал другой ряд, так по кругу, подгиная платку, и по чуть-чуть, микросхема ножками выгиналась в среду.


[uquote="GoldenAndy",url="/forum/viewtopic.php?p=4175546#p4175546"]...свой ремонтник...без фена запросто выпаивал большие чипы...VooDoo2...- просовывал тонкую-тонкую нихромовую проволочку под ряд ножек чипа и, прогревая ноги последовательно паяльником, вытаскивал эту проволочку под ножками...[/uquote]

- да - интересный метод - но он гнёт ноги - и, не известно - восстановимо ли оно после этого...
При чём, как мне кажется, ноги будут натягиваться - и, потом, выпрямляться обратно, и, если олово на ножке не успеет застыть - то она (вполне вероятно) приварится обвратно.

Я думал о подобном методе - только с применением прокладки: некую пластину подсовываем под каждую ножку, которая в этот момент отпаиваемая, и получается поддерживаемо. И пластинку можно взять потоньше, так-как она - пошире - и запас по прочности имеется. Пластинку надо только подыскать подходящую: тонкую, гибкую, теплостойкую, нелудимую. Думаю - слюда подойдёт.

Проволокой, да и даже прокладкой по одной стороне четыре раза, получается не ровно: фен - приличней.

[uquote="oleg63m",url="/forum/viewtopic.php?p=4175767#p4175767"]...я бы посоветовал на крайняк взять, хотя-бы строительный фен.[/uquote]

Во!- сейчас ваяю из жести насадку для своего строительного фена. Делаю на два конца - Т-образно: чтоб треть в одну сторону- а две - в другую - и выбирать можно было

[uquote="oleg63m",url="/forum/viewtopic.php?p=4175767#p4175767"]включить его через диммер.[/uquote]

Ну с насадкой всё-равно возиться придётся (под корпус микры) - так-что с диммером я не буду заморачиваться - не обязательное дополнение.


*********************************************************
Боже!: посмотрел я на сборку это доктора - так его на порядок труднее собрать и на моём микроконтроллере с подключением возиться, - нежели перепаять феном новый... - у меня уже голова кругом идёт от всего этово..
Отвечателям просто нравиться печатать буквы: для значимости советуют проверить то или это, или все равно что; обычно - зачем это надо и методы проверки остаются за кадром.
Аватара пользователя
oleg63m
Друг Кота
Сообщения: 20132
Зарегистрирован: Чт сен 01, 2011 12:53:27
Откуда: ТьмуТаракания. Почетный житель подмостовья
Контактная информация:

Re: Все про USBAsp

Сообщение oleg63m »

[uquote="Levontay",url="/forum/viewtopic.php?p=4176505#p4176505"]с диммером я не буду заморачиваться .[/uquote]
дело ваше, но фены разные бывают, можно и перегреть.
мегу найти не могу, экспремента не будет :cry:
Шекспир сказал: Судить меня -дано лишь Богу, другим я укажу дорогу... https://natribu.org/
Я его полностью поддерживаю.
Программирую на Fuse AtmelAVR.
Аватара пользователя
GoldenAndy
Поставщик валерьянки для Кота
Сообщения: 1925
Зарегистрирован: Чт июл 28, 2016 07:58:37
Откуда: Kyiv, UA
Контактная информация:

Re: Все про USBAsp

Сообщение GoldenAndy »

Levontay писал(а): да - интересный метод - но он гнёт ноги - и, не известно - восстановимо ли оно после этого...
Ну VooDoo2 после этого у меня долго работала. И потом я продал и еще у кого то она работала.

Если облом возиться с доктором, преходной платой под 328 мегу - то зачем фен?
Ножом острым канцелярским прорезать выводы и забыть.
ИзображениеИзображение
Изображение
 
Telegram               Лучшая благодарность ->
[+]
Аватара пользователя
Borodach
Модератор
Сообщения: 22896
Зарегистрирован: Пн дек 08, 2008 19:28:04
Откуда: 10км от Москвы на Север

Re: Все про USBAsp

Сообщение Borodach »

Переходную платку сбросьте, у кого есть.
Аватара пользователя
oleg63m
Друг Кота
Сообщения: 20132
Зарегистрирован: Чт сен 01, 2011 12:53:27
Откуда: ТьмуТаракания. Почетный житель подмостовья
Контактная информация:

Re: Все про USBAsp

Сообщение oleg63m »

на что?
Шекспир сказал: Судить меня -дано лишь Богу, другим я укажу дорогу... https://natribu.org/
Я его полностью поддерживаю.
Программирую на Fuse AtmelAVR.
Аватара пользователя
Borodach
Модератор
Сообщения: 22896
Зарегистрирован: Пн дек 08, 2008 19:28:04
Откуда: 10км от Москвы на Север

Re: Все про USBAsp

Сообщение Borodach »

На 328 в планаре. Можно и на 324 ...
Ответить

Вернуться в «AVR»